28 class FremantleRotation(object):
29 """thp's screen rotation for Maemo 5
31 Simply instantiate an object of this class and let it auto-rotate
32 your StackableWindows depending on the device orientation.
34 If you need to relayout a window, connect to its "configure-event"
35 signal and measure the ratio of width/height and relayout for that.
37 You can set the mode for rotation to AUTOMATIC (default), NEVER or
38 ALWAYS with the set_mode() method.
